Como usar a conclusão do código do Copilot para o Data Warehouse do Fabric
Aplica-se a:✅Depósito no Microsoft Fabric
O Copilot para Data Warehouse fornece sugestões inteligentes de código T-SQL no estilo de preenchimento automático para simplificar sua experiência de codificação.
À medida que você começa a escrever código T-SQL ou comentários no editor, o Copilot para Data Warehouse aproveita o esquema do depósito e o contexto da guia de consulta para complementar o IntelliSense existente com sugestões de código embutido. As conclusões podem vir em durações variadas - às vezes a conclusão da linha atual, e às vezes um novo bloco de código. As conclusões do código oferecem suporte a todos os tipos de consultas T-SQL: DDL (linguagem de definição de dados), DQL (linguagem de consulta de dados) e DML (linguagem de manipulação de dados). Você pode aceitar toda ou parte de uma sugestão, ou continuar digitando e ignorar as sugestões. O recurso também pode gerar sugestões alternativas para você escolher.
Pré-requisitos
- Seu administrador precisa habilitar a opção de locatário antes de você começar a usar o Copilot. Para obter mais informações, consulte Configurações de locatário do Copilot.
- Sua capacidade F64 ou P1 precisa estar em uma das regiões listadas neste artigo, Disponibilidade da região Fabric.
- Se seu locatário ou capacidade estiver fora dos EUA ou da França, o Copilot estará desabilitado por padrão, a menos que o administrador do locatário do Fabric habilite a configuração de locatário Dados enviados para o Azure OpenAI podem ser processados fora da região geográfica, do limite de conformidade ou da instância de nuvem nacional do seu locatário no portal do Administrador do Fabric.
- Não há suporte para o Copilot no Microsoft Fabric em SKUs de avaliação. Há suporte apenas para SKUs pagos (F64 ou superior ou P1 ou superior).
- Para obter mais informações, consulte Visão geral do Copilot no Fabric e no Power BI.
Como as conclusões do código podem ajudá-lo?
A conclusão de código melhora sua produtividade e fluxo de trabalho no Copilot para Data Warehouse, reduzindo a carga cognitiva de escrever código T-SQL. Acelera a escrita de código, evita erros de sintaxe e erros de digitação e melhora a qualidade do código. Fornece sugestões úteis e ricas em contexto diretamente no editor de consultas. Se você é novo ou experiente com SQL, a conclusão do código ajuda você a economizar tempo e energia ao escrever código SQL e se concentrar em projetar, otimizar e testar seu depósito.
Principais recursos
- Preenchimento automático de consultas parcialmente escritas: o Copilot pode fornecer sugestões ou conclusões de código SQL com reconhecimento de contexto para sua consulta T-SQL parcialmente escrita.
- Gerar sugestões a partir de comentários: você pode guiar o Copilot usando comentários que descrevam sua lógica e finalidade de código, usando linguagem natural. Deixe o comentário (usando
--
) no início da consulta e o Copilot irá gerar a consulta correspondente.
Introdução
Verifique a configuração Mostrar conclusões do Copilot está habilitada nas configurações do warehouse.
Comece a escrever sua consulta no editor de consultas SQL dentro do depósito. À medida que você digita, o Copilot fornecerá sugestões de código em tempo real e conclusões da sua consulta, apresentando um texto fantasma esmaecido.
Em seguida, você pode aceitar as sugestões com a tecla Tab ou descartá-las. Se não quiser aceitar uma sugestão inteira do Copilot, use o atalho de teclado Ctrl+Direita para aceitar a próxima palavra de uma sugestão.
O Copilot pode fornecer diferentes sugestões para a mesma entrada. Você pode passar o mouse sobre a sugestão para visualizar as outras opções.
Para ajudar o Copilot a entender a consulta que você está escrevendo, você pode fornecer contexto sobre o código que espera ao deixar um comentário com
--
. Por exemplo, você pode especificar qual objeto, condição ou método de depósito usar. O Copilot pode até mesmo completar automaticamente seu comentário para ajudá-lo a escrever comentários claros e precisos de forma mais eficiente.